Don't Miss Job Alerts

๐Ÿš€ Launch Your Career with FreshersPortal!


๐ŸŽฏ Don't Miss Out Job Opportunities! ✨


๐Ÿ”— Join our groups now & stay Updated! ๐Ÿ”ฅ




Microsoft Software Engineering Full-Time Opportunity 2025

๐ŸŒ Microsoft is hiring Software Engineers for its 2025 batch through an exclusive Off Campus Recruitment Drive. If you're a recent graduate in Computer Science or a related technical discipline, this is your gateway to joining one of the most innovative tech giants in the world. This full-time opportunity allows you to work remotely from anywhere in India, with the role based in Bangalore. You'll contribute to Azure Storage, one of the world’s most scalable, distributed storage systems—shaping the backbone of Microsoft’s cloud infrastructure. A golden chance for freshers to build large-scale, world-class software systems.



Microsoft
Job Role Software Engineering
Qualification Bachelor’s Degree
Batch 2022/2023/2024/2025
Experience Freshers
Salary ₹ 77K Per Month(Expected)
Location Remote
Last Date ASAP
Apply Link Below


✅ Eligibility Criteria

๐Ÿ“Œ Bachelor’s Degree in Computer Science or related field
๐Ÿ“Œ Proficiency in coding with C, C++, C#, Java, JavaScript, or Python
๐Ÿ“Œ Strong understanding of data structures, system design, and algorithms
๐Ÿ“Œ Must meet Microsoft’s Cloud Background Check criteria
๐Ÿ“Œ Good communication, logical thinking & team collaboration

๐Ÿงพ Job Description

As a Software Engineer at Microsoft, you will:
๐Ÿง  Build and optimize distributed file systems for Azure Cloud Storage
๐Ÿ’พ Develop scalable solutions that manage meta-data and data service layers
⚙️ Write and implement clean, reusable, and secure code
๐Ÿงฐ Handle systems monitoring and resolve service downtime issues as a DRI
๐Ÿ“ˆ Stay updated with evolving technologies to enhance storage reliability and performance
๐Ÿงฌ Engage with both software and hardware optimization for hyperscale environments

๐ŸŒŸ Why Join Microsoft?

๐Ÿš€ Innovate at Scale: Work on one of the largest storage systems on the planet
๐ŸŒ Global Impact: Your code will impact millions across the world
๐Ÿ  Flexible Work: Up to 100% remote option
๐Ÿค Collaborative Culture: Work with world-class engineers in a diverse team
๐Ÿ“š Learning Ecosystem: Access to internal training, mentorship, and certifications

๐Ÿข About Microsoft 

Microsoft is a global technology leader pioneering in cloud computing, artificial intelligence, enterprise software, and innovation. With world-renowned products and services like Azure, Office 365, and GitHub, Microsoft empowers millions of developers worldwide. Their commitment to remote work and inclusivity makes them a top choice for software engineers.

๐Ÿงฉ Other Highlights

๐Ÿ”ง Core Skills: C, C++, Python, Java, JavaScript, C#, Distributed Systems
☁️ Cloud Stack: Azure Storage, Microsoft Data Centers, High Scale Infrastructure
๐Ÿ”’ Security Compliance: Microsoft Cloud Background Screening
๐Ÿ› ️ Tools: Visual Studio, GitHub, Azure DevOps
๐ŸŽ“ Great for: Freshers aiming for backend development, systems engineering, and cloud optimization

๐Ÿ“ฅ How to Apply?

Interested and eligible candidates can apply online using the below link:



Jobs by Qualification
B.Tech BBA
B.Sc B.Com
M.Sc M.Com
MCA MBA
BCA M.Tech


❓ 5 Interview Questions & Sample Answers

Q1. What is a distributed system and why is it useful?
๐Ÿ—จ️ A distributed system consists of multiple nodes working together to appear as a single system. It enhances scalability, fault tolerance, and resource sharing.

Q2. Explain memory leaks and how to prevent them in C++.
๐Ÿ—จ️ Memory leaks occur when dynamically allocated memory isn't deallocated. Use smart pointers like std::unique_ptr or std::shared_ptr to manage memory safely.

Q3. Describe how hash tables work.
๐Ÿ—จ️ Hash tables store key-value pairs and use a hash function to map keys to indices in an array, allowing constant-time lookups in ideal conditions.

Q4. What is the difference between multithreading and multiprocessing?
๐Ÿ—จ️ Multithreading shares the same memory space among threads, improving speed for I/O-heavy tasks, while multiprocessing uses separate memory, better for CPU-bound tasks.

Q5. How would you optimize a file storage system for faster reads?
๐Ÿ—จ️ Use indexing, caching frequently accessed data, compressing files, and using parallel reads or memory-mapped files to boost performance.

The Microsoft Software Engineering Full-Time Opportunity 2025 is a golden chance for freshers to kickstart a career in tech. Join the Azure team and build world-class distributed systems from the comfort of your home. Work on high-performance systems at Microsoft India and redefine the future of storage tech. #MicrosoftOffCampusDrive #MicrosoftHiring2025 #SoftwareEngineerJobs #AzureStorageJobs #DistributedSystemsJobs #MicrosoftFreshersJobs #BangaloreITJobs #WorkFromHomeITJobs #CPlusPlusJobs #JavaDeveloperFreshers #PythonJobsIndia #MicrosoftCareerOpportunities #SystemDesignJobs #CloudJobsForFreshers #MicrosoftInternships2025 #FreshersInTech #MicrosoftSoftwareEngineer #RemoteEngineeringJobs #TechJobsIndia #MicrosoftCloudJobs #BackendEngineer2025 #MicrosoftCareersIndia #JobForFreshers #CSGraduateJobs #MicrosoftHiringFreshers #AzureJobsIndia #DataStructuresJobs #MicrosoftDistributedSystems #FullTimeOpportunity2025 #MicrosoftCodingJobs #EntryLevelTechJobs